Porsche’s move took three years of careful maneuvering. It was darkly brilliant, a wealth transfer ingeniously conceived like few we’ve ever seen. Betting the right way, Porsche roiled the financial markets and took the hedge funds for a fortune.

Betting the wrong way, Adolf Merckle took his life.

A very readable explanation of a winner-takes-all poker game, where a number of hedge funds got taken by Porsche. How strategically played by Porsche may not be known for many years, but hedge funds bet like mad against them … and lost all.
